Well, forget all that for a moment because this Fallout 3 remake is looking pretty darn sweet.

It comes from a small team who are working to remake Fallout 3 with newer technology to bring it up to today’s standards. This means upscaled textures, better lighting, and ray tracing turned up to 11.

According to the creators they were using several ray tracing options including “global illumination, shadows, reflections, and ambient occlusion.” And from what we’ve seen, it’s looking lush.

Whether this project turns into anything more than a bunch of videos, it’s hard to say. But even then, it’s a great trip down memory lane to a game that has stood the test of time.

Fallout 3 is held up as one of the best RPGs of all -time and in the franchise only comes second to New Vegas, which steals the show. It was the first time the franchise went 3D and the immersive feeling of the wasteland was terrific.

This team isn’t the only one eyeing Fallout 3 for a remake, but whether Bethesda decides to do it themselves, is hard to say. Perhaps, given the current love for the series, it may become a solid possibility.
